Bid to reform Legion branch

A bid to reform the Arran branch of the Royal British Legion is being made.

A meeting in The Douglas Hotel, Brodick, on Wednesday October 5 at 2pm will be attended by the chief executive officer of Legion Scotland, as the organisation is now known north of the border, Kevin Gray and administrative manager Claire Armstrong from HQ in Edinburgh.

Membership of the legion is open to service personnel, veterans and anyone interested in supporting the ideals of the Legion.
